Ribadeo is a town located in the province of Lugo, in the autonomous community of Galicia, in the northwest of Spain. It is situated on the coast of the Bay of Biscay and is known for its beautiful beaches, historic landmarks, and natural landscapes.
Highlights in Ribadeo:
One of the main attractions the Praia das Catedrais (Cathedral Beach), accessible only during low tide, and visitors must obtain a permit in advance to access it.
The town’s historic center features buildings and structures dating back to the medieval era, including the 13th-century Romanesque church of Santa Maria do Campo and the Torre dos Moreno, a 15th-century tower that served as a lookout for pirates and invaders.
